Safety instructions

Caution: This device must only be used to process and heat
media whose flash point is over the safe temperature limit set
point (50 to 380°C).
The adjusted safety temperature must always be appropriate for
25°C below the flash point of the used liquid.
Examine regularly (we recommend every 4 weeks) the function
of the safety temperature limiter. For this the safety temperatu-
re must be changed around at least 2 scale parts of the value
already stopped and be accomplished the attitude as under
RET BC 1001
"adjusting the safety temperature delimitation SAFE temp"
decribed. By the exceeding of the adjusted safety temperature
(e.g. rotary button "temp" posed on max.) you can examine the

When using PTFE-coated magnetic bars, the following hase to be
13
noted: Chemical reactions of PTFE occur in contact with molten
14
or dissolved alkaline and alkaline - earth metals, as well as with
fine-particled powders of metals of the 2. and 3. group of the peri-
21
odical system at temperatures above 300-400°C.
22
Only elementary fluorine, chlorine trifluoride und alkaline metals
23
do attack PTFE, halogen hydrocarbons have a reversibly swelling
effect.
Source: Römpps Chemie-Lexikon and „Ullmann" Bd.19
